在资源文件中设置属性

时间:2011-07-25 12:45:18

标签: c# asp.net telerik embedded-resource

我的网站需要法语和英语,我正在使用资源文件来完成此任务。我的老板现在想在文本框中看到示例文本。我们正在使用telerik控件执行此操作,并且我尝试将示例文本设置为英语或法语。

我可能需要为此制作一个自定义控件,这样我就可以有一个额外的标签作为示例文本。

我的问题是:您是否可以在资源文件中设置除text属性之外的其他属性。

ie:Label1Resource.EmptyMessage.Text

将资源设置为:清空消息

感谢。

1 个答案:

答案 0 :(得分:3)

对于本地资源,ASP.NET匹配元素中的属性:

<asp:Label ID="lblErrorMsg" runat="server" meta:resourcekey="lblErrorMsg" Text="Label">  
</asp:Label>

因此,在资源文件中,您可以将“Text”的本地化文本定义为:

  

名称: lblErrorMsg.Text 和值:标签

如果在名为 EmptyText 的telrik控件上有一个属性,您将在资源文件中解决该属性:

  

name: lblErrorMsg.EmptyText value:您的文字